Enabling Port Security

By default, the port security feature is disabled in Cisco Nexus 5000 Series switches.
To enable port security, perform this task:
Command
Step 1
switch# configuration terminal
Step 2
switch(config)# port-security enable
switch(config)# no port-security enable
